    Alex Marvez of the Sporting News is reporting that the Jets are hiring Kevin Greene as their new outside linebackers coach.

    There was some talk that the Jets were going to hire Clint Hurtt to coach outside linebackers, but he later joined the Seahawks’ coaching staff.

    Greene will replace Mark Collins on the Jets’ defensive coaching staff.

    Greene, 54, former fifth-round pick of the Rams back in 1985. He played 15 years in the NFL for the Rams, Steelers, Panthers and 49ers before he was elected to the Pro Football Hall of Fame last year.

    The Packers hired him as their OLBs coach back in 2009 and he helped them win a Super Bowl title during the 2010 season. Greene later stepped away from coaching to spend more time with his family, but he’s been seen visiting with a few teams in recent years, so the possibility was always there that he could return to coaching in the NFL at some point.
